How does sickle cell anemia affect the nervous system?.

Respuesta :

raidenryder635
raidenryder635 raidenryder635
  • 07-05-2022

Answer:

brain complications

Explanation:

Children with sickle cell disease are at risk for brain damage because their irregularly shaped sickle cells can interrupt blood flow to the brain. Complete clogging of blood flow to the brain can lead to an “obvious” stroke.
